2017-09-16 Thread Lamar Owen
Greg, according to the release notes "Known Issues" section (  https://wiki.centos.org/Manuals/ReleaseNotes/CentOS7?action=show=Manuals%2FReleaseNotes%2FCentOS7.1708#head-281c090cc4fbc6bb5c7d4cd82a266fce807eee7c ) you need to run "yum downgrade libgpod" first.  I have updated a dozen or so
